Coastal walks along Moville's scenic shore path offer spectacular views of Lough Foyle and the Inishowen Peninsula. Grab a pint at a traditional pub before exploring nearby Greencastle Maritime Museum or taking a ferry to Magilligan Point.

Best time to go to Moville

The best time to visit Moville can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Moville fal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Moville fal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
February41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.7°F (10.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June55.4°F (13.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
July57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
September54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Moville

When planning your trip to Moville, County Donegal, you can fly into two major airports. Letterkenny Airfield (LTR) is situated 48.3km away, with nearby accommodation options like the 4-star Clanree Hotel & Leisure Centre, just 1.6km from the airport, and the Radisson Blu Hotel, 4.8km away. Alternatively, Donegal Airport (CFN) is located 83.7km from Moville, with options such as the 4-star Teac Chondai Thatched Cottage, 4.8km from the airport, and the 3-star Caisleain Oir Hotel, only 1.6km away. Both airports offer convenient access to these hotels through various transport services.

What's the weather like in Moville?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Moville is 1016 mm.
